Button function description
“ ”: single cooling mode “ ”: single mixing mode “ ” ice cream mode “ ”: power off mode
Motor self-protection function
W en t e ice cream becomes arder, t e mixing motor mig t be blocked. T en t e motor protection
device makes t e mixing motor stop working by detecting its temperature to ensure t e life of t e motor.
Controlling the Volume of the Ingredients
To avoid overflow and waste, please make sure t at t e ingredients do not exceed 60% of capacity of t e
removable tank (Ice cream expands w en being formed)

USING YOUR APPLIANCE
T e material for making ice cream can be prepared according to t e individual recipe.
T e material and t e cooling tank do not need to be frozen in t e refrigerator in advance. T e built-in
compressor of t e mac ine can directly freeze t e material and make it into ice cream.
Example of recipe base:
It can be made according to t e formula specified below. After t e formula mixture is evenly mixed, it can
be made into ice cream wit in 60 minutes.
Cream: 240g
Milk powder: 180g
Water: 240g

CLEANING
•Always switc off, unplug and dismantle before cleaning.
•Never put t e power unit in water or let t e cord or plug get wet.
•Do not was parts in t e dis was er.
•Do not clean wit scouring powders, steel wool pads, or ot er abrasive materials.
•Take out t e mixing blade, tank, lid and wipe t em wit a dampened sponge
•Allow drying t oroug ly wit a dry clot , t en return t e component to t e ome position.
